> Fix the following compilation warning:
> 
>   ar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c: In function 'gpmc_probe_generic_child':
>   ar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c:1477:4: warning: format '%x' expects argument of type 'unsigned int', but argument 4 has type 'resource_size_t' [-Wformat]

> di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c
> index ed946df..3cd7074 100644
> ---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c
> +++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/gpmc.c
> @@ -1474,7 +1474,7 @@ static int gpmc_probe_generic_child(struct platform_device *pdev,
>  	ret = gpmc_cs_remap(cs, res.start);
>  	if (ret < 0) {
>  		dev_err(&pdev->dev, "cannot remap GPMC CS %d to 0x%x\n",
> -			cs, res.start);
> +			cs, (unsigned)res.start);
>  		goto err;
>  	}

You should just change the format for dev_err instead of the casting.
